This commit is contained in:
Daniel 2023-11-25 10:05:59 +08:00
parent 063edb8804
commit 006cc6df8d
No known key found for this signature in database
GPG key ID: 86211BA83DF03017

View file

@ -1560,11 +1560,14 @@ export class WYSIWYG {
}
this.escapeInline(protyle, range, event);
if ((/^\d{1}$/.test(event.data) || event.data === "" || event.data === "“" || event.data === "「")) {
if ((/^\d{1}$/.test(event.data) || event.data === "" || event.data === "“" ||
// 百度输入法中文反双引号 https://github.com/siyuan-note/siyuan/issues/9686
event.data === "”" ||
event.data === "「")) {
clearTimeout(timeout); // https://github.com/siyuan-note/siyuan/issues/9179
timeout = window.setTimeout(() => {
input(protyle, blockElement, range, true); // 搜狗拼音数字后面句号变为点Mac 反向双引号无法输入
}, event.data === "“" ? Constants.TIMEOUT_INPUT : 0); // 百度输入法中文双引号光标跳动需要延迟 https://github.com/siyuan-note/siyuan/issues/9686
});
} else {
input(protyle, blockElement, range, true);
}